Senior Administrative Coordinator

2 weeks ago


Christchurch, Canterbury, New Zealand University of Canterbury Full time

We are seeking a highly organized and experienced Personal Assistant to join our Senior Leadership Team at the University of Canterbury. The successful candidate will provide professional and confidential support to the Assistant Vice-Chancellor Engagement.

The role involves complex calendar management, minute taking, and ensuring timely preparation of documentation for meetings. This is a diverse role with various aspects changing throughout the year, providing opportunities to expand as a customer-focused personal assistant.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Managing a diverse and busy workload
  • Diary management with multiple calendars
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
  • Maintaining confidentiality and discretion
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office applications and databases

Requirements:

  • 4 years' experience in a senior administrative or personal assistant role
  • Ability to adapt to changing priorities and deadlines
  • Professional attitude, enthusiasm, and motivation to thrive in a team environment

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ys variety and can adapt to changing circumstances.
